When you use neural analytics (see General information on Neural analytics), the hardware platform must meet the following requirements:
The neural network analytics supports the following devices: CPU, GPU NVIDIA, VPU (Intel NCS).

If you use a CPU below 6th Generation Intel® Core™ processors, the operation of detectors isn't guaranteed. |
If you use a processor with Intel AMX instructions along with Windows Server 2019 OS on the server, we recommend updating the OS to Windows Server 2022 for successful operation of neural analytics. |
Compute Capability 3.5 − 8.6.

When you use a GPU, a single neural network consumes 500 MB of video memory. For example, to run any number of fire and smoke detection channels based on neural networks, you must use a graphics card with 1GB of memory or more. You can use multiple video cards in your system.
For the correct operation of each detector, video requirements must be met. The requirements are specific for each detector and are given in the corresponding sections (see Configuring detection modules). |
